#cffdd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cffdd2 is composed of 81.2% red, 99.2%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 17%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 123.9 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 90.2%. #cffdd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9ffba5.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#cffdd2 color description : Light grayish lime green.
#cffdd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cffdd2 has RGB values of R:207, G:253,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 13630930.
